Transportation
William Gadd was transported on the Pitt, departing 31st May 1791 and arriving 14th Feb 1792 with 406 passengers.
Built Thames, England 1780. 775 tons. Rig type: S.

Australia, Convict Indents Name William Gadd Date of Conviction 21 Feb 1791 Place of Conviction Surrey Vessel Pitt Date of Arrival 14 Feb 1792 1792 - POSSIBLE BURIAL RECORD. New South Wales, Australia, St. John's Parramatta, Burials Name Wm Gayed - CONVICT. Burial Date 31 Jul 1792
